In this study, a fuzzy multi-objective framework is performed for optimization of a hybrid microgrid (HMG) including photovoltaic (PV) and wind energy sources linked with battery energy storage.
This paper proposes to resolve optimal solar photovoltaic (SPV) system locations and sizes in electrical distribution networks using a novel Archimedes optimization algorithm (AOA) inspired by physical principles in order to minimize network dependence and gre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ions to the greatest extent possible.
This paper proposes an optimal sizing and siting scheme for the battery storage and photovoltaic generation aiming at improving power system resilience. The concept of capacity accessibility for both electricity demand and non-black-start (NB-S) generating units is proposed to evaluate the reachability to the power and energy capacity during .
Reasonable photovoltaic-energy storage capacity allocation and demand side response can stabilize the volatility of photovoltaic. Thus, this paper establishes an optimal capacity allocation method of photovoltaic-energy storage of grid-connected microgrid considering demand response.

How do PV panel types affect capacity allocation with ESS?
Impact of PV panel types on capacity allocation with ESS The allocation of energy storage in the PV system not only reduces the PV rejection rate, but also cuts the peaks and fills the valley through the energy storage system, and improves the economics of the whole system through the time-sharing electricity price policy.
What is the energy storage capacity of a photovoltaic system?
Specifically, the energy storage power is 11.18 kW, the energy storage capacity is 13.01 kWh, the installed photovoltaic power is 2789.3 kW, the annual photovoltaic power generation hours are 2552.3 h, and the daily electricity purchase cost of the PV-storage combined system is 11.77 $. 3.3.2. Are photovoltaic penetration and energy storage configuration nonlinear?
According to the capacity configuration model in Section 2.2, Photovoltaic penetration and the energy storage configuration are nonlinear. Considering the charging power and other effects, if you use mathematical methods such as enumeration, the calculation is complicated and the efficiency is extremely low.
